A geologist might use a piece of tile to identify a mineral because the unglazed surface of the tile can serve as an effective tool for performing a streak test. This test involves rubbing the mineral across the tile to observe the color of the streak it leaves behind, which can be a key characteristic for mineral identification. The streak color can differ from the mineral's appearance, providing additional information for accurate classification. This simple method is practical and widely used in fieldwork and laboratory settings.

The streak of a mineral can distinguish between two samples that have the same color. The streak is often a different color. To test streak, use a streak plate. This is a piece of unglazed porcelain, like the back side of a tile.

The test is called a streak test and it leaves a powdered form of the mineral on the porcelain. The powdered mineral reveals the true color, of the mineral specimen, which may or may not match the color of the specimen.
